Case description

A case of severe ptosis, operated by Singh orbital approach. The surgery is easy, no tissue is removed, only rearranged. There are minimal chances of lagophthalmos. Recovery is fast. The patient wants to go home after 3 hours, but I detain him for 24 hours at least. The current techniques anchors the Muller muscle and pulls forwards the floating LPS wrapped in tenon capsule. It is more comfortable to me with the recent modification of technique.
